Climate overview of Zarasai
Zarasai, Utena county, Lithuania, experiences significant temperature variation throughout the year. Summers bring daytime highs of 24°C (75°F) in July, while winters cool to -1°C (30°F) in February.
The city receives around 753 mm (30 in) of rain/snowfall per year. August is the wettest month and March the driest. The most sunshine falls in June, with an average of 8.7 hours of daily sunshine.

Monthly Temperature in Zarasai
Depending on the time of the year, temperatures range from comfortable to very cold in Zarasai. On average, daytime temperatures range from a comfortable 24°C (75°F) in July to a very cold -1°C (30°F) in February.
Nighttime temperatures range from 14°C (57°F) in July to -6°C (21°F) in February.

Rainfall in Zarasai
Generally, Zarasai has a moderate amount of precipitation, averaging 753 mm (30 in) of rain/snowfall annually. The amount of precipitation varies moderately throughout the year. The wettest month, August, sees around 85 mm (3.3 in) of rainfall, perfect for those who enjoy a bit of rain now and then. Sunshine Hours in Zarasai
In Zarasai, summer days are longer and more sunny, with daily sunshine hours peaking at 8.7 hours in June. As the darker season arrives, the brightness of the sun becomes less. December sees a soft sun for only 0.7 hours per average day.

Frequently asked questions about the climate in Zarasai
What is the best time to visit Zarasai?
June, July and August typically offer the most optimal weather in Zarasai. In contrast, January, February, March, November and December tend to have less optimal conditions.
What temperatures can I expect in Zarasai?
Daytime highs range from -1°C (30°F) in February to 24°C (75°F) in July. Nighttime lows range from -6°C (21°F) to 14°C (57°F). Temperatures vary considerably through the year.
How much rain does Zarasai get?
Annual rainfall is around 753 mm (30 in). August is the wettest month with 85 mm (3.3 in), while March is the driest with 46 mm (1.8 in).
How sunny is Zarasai?
Zarasai receives around 1,688 hours of sunshine per year. June is the sunniest month with 261 hours, while December is the cloudiest with just 22 hours.
